Key Characteristics of USDC and Optimism USDC
USDCoin (USDC) is a fully USD-backed stablecoin issued by Centre, a partnership between Circle and Coinbase. It is designed to provide price stability, transparency, and ease of use in digital transactions. USDC maintains a 1:1 peg with the US dollar, with each coin supposedly backed by a corresponding USD held in reserve. Optimism USDC operates on the Optimism layer 2 chain, offering faster transaction speeds and lower fees, while preserving the stability and liquidity of USDC.
Both versions are built on blockchain technology, but Optimism USDC significantly enhances scalability, which is crucial for high-volume transactions and DeFi applications. Additionally, both tokens follow strict regulatory standards, ensuring user confidence and compliance.

Working Principle
USDC operates on the principle of **collateralized backing**. When a user purchases USDC, an equivalent amount of USD is held in reserve by licensed custodians. This backing ensures tranquility and maintained peg. Each USDC is issued with a corresponding claim on a USD reserve, and regular attestations verify the backing.
On the blockchain, USDC functions as a fungible token that can be transferred instantly across borders. When users transfer USDC, the transaction is validated on the respective blockchain (Ethereum or Optimism). The Optimism version leverages layer 2 scaling solutions to process transactions off-chain, which are then aggregated and committed to the main Ethereum chain, ensuring faster and cheaper transactions without compromising security.

Risks of USDC and Optimism USDC
Despite its advantages, USDC faces certain risks:
- Regulatory Risks: Changes in regulations can impact its issuance, use, or acceptance.
- Reserve Risks: If the USD reserves are not adequately maintained or audited, trust could erode.
- Smart Contract Vulnerabilities: Bugs or exploits within blockchain protocols could jeopardize user holdings.
- Market Risks: Although designed for stability, extreme market conditions could impact liquidity and redemption processes.
Regulation
USDC operates under a framework emphasizing *regulatory compliance*. Issuers like Circle adhere to stringent AML (Anti-Money Laundering) and KYC (Know Your Customer) policies. Regulatory authorities worldwide are scrutinizing stablecoins to prevent misuse for illicit activities. The eventual regulation of stablecoins like USDC aims to balance innovation with consumer protection, potentially including reserve audits, transparency mandates, and licensing requirements.
